Pros

Collaborate with the best and smartest, learn and able to challenge and improve yourself constantly, very collaborative atmosphere, work hard play hard. If you want to learn or try something new, this is the place to be.

Cons

Not much of a work-life balance, i.e. people work on weekends and nights. Intensity and pace of things going on can be overwhelming at times, fairly high stress work place. Facilities are decent, but definitely not the best.

Pros

High quality core facilities and well resourced labs. Countless brilliant colleagues who can serve as mentors and collaborators

Cons

Students and Postdocs are expensive due to high overhead, so unreasonably high productivity is often expected compared to other institutions. PIs are typically stretched very thin. Most departments/labs are very space limited which makes it harder to do safe and productive research.
